-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
选择題(共15題,每題2分)
1.下列选项中,可以让角色只說输入内容的最终一种字的代码是?()
A.
B.
C.
D.
2.如下代码运行完毕后,变量【k】的值会变成?()
** B.nheE C.lpat D.tapl
3.如下代码运行完毕后,变量【z】的值為?()
** B.6 C.12 D.24
4.如下代码运行完毕后,可以得出变量【mul】的值為?()
** B.135 C.225 D.675
5.如下代码运行完毕后,变量【x】的值為?()
** B. 51 C.59 D.77
6.如下图所示,小核桃想要制作出一种照片墙,那么如下代码中的1,2部分依次应当填写的数字是?()
**,7 B.7,5 C.5,5 D.7,7
7.舞台效果如下图所示,要绘制这样一种图案,需要在代码部分依次填入的数字是?()
A. 12,8,45,30 B.8,6,60,45
**,6,60,30 D.6,8,45,60
8.列表如下图所示,想要通过代码实現互换第一项与第三项数据,下列选项中的代码对的的是?()
A.
B.
C.
D.
9.列表和代码如下图所示,代码运行完毕后,变量【m】的值為?()
** B.51 C.58 D.96
10.列表和代码如下图所示,代码运行完毕后,变量【ave】的值為?()
** B.43 C.53 D.78
11.有四只小老鼠一块出去偷食物(它們都偷食物了),回来時族長问它們都偷了什么食物。老鼠A說:我們每个人都偷了奶酪。老鼠B說:我只偷了一颗樱桃。老鼠C說:我没偷奶酪。老鼠D說:有人没偷奶酪。族長仔细观测了一下,发現它們当中只有一只老鼠說了实话。那么下列的评论对的的是?()
A.所有老鼠都偷了奶酪
B.所有的老鼠都没有偷奶酪
C.有些老鼠没偷奶酪
D.老鼠B偷了一颗樱桃
12.根据下图的规律,可以推测出最终一种位置的应当填的图形為?()
A. B.
C. D.
13.一群小猴正在聚会,猴主人要把新鲜的桃子分給其他的八个同伴,假如想要每个猴子分到的桃子数量都不一样样,那么至少需要多少桃子?()
** B.16 C.36 D.64
14.如下代码运行完毕后来,变量【ans】的值為?()
** B.965 C.3569 D.9653
15.在动物园里,喂养员要給8种不一样的动物喂食,每种动物的喂食時间分别為3、9、6、5、8、2、7、6,假如可以任意调整喂食的次序,那么这些动物等待食物的最短時间為?()
** B.121 C.167 D.206
判断題(共10題,每題2分)
16.如下代码运行完毕后,变量【st】的值有也許為scr。()
17.如下代码运行后,变量【a】的值為moPole。()
18.在Scratch中,函数可以被其他角色调用。()
19.运行下图代码后,角色会說5、4、3、2、1各一秒。()
20.如下代码中的内层循环一共执行了100次。()
21.如下代码运行完毕后,可以在舞台上留下右侧的图案。()
22.假如删除列表的其中一项数据,那么这一项背面的数据编号不变。()
23.如下代码运行完毕后,列表【numbers】中的数据依次為1、2、3、4、5。()
24.小明有8个玻璃球,其中一种略微重某些,不过找出这个球的惟一措施是将两个球放在天平上对比,因此至少要称3次才能找出这个较重的球。()
25.排序算法中的排序次数与初始元素序列的排列无关。()
编程題(共5題,每題10分)
26.学校有这样一条阶梯,假如你每步跨2阶,那么最终剩余1阶,假如你每步跨3阶,那么你最终剩2阶,假如你每步跨5阶,那么最终剩4阶,假如你每步跨6阶,那么最终剩5阶,只有当你每步跨7阶時,最终才恰好走完,一阶不剩。請你运用编程计算出这条阶梯究竟有多少阶?
(1)准备工作
在预留文献中的Cat角色中编程。
(2)功能实現
1)新建变量【m】用来表达阶梯的阶数。
2)通过循环判断算出成果并对的无误。
27.小紅在列表里面存了某些数据,不过发現次序是錯的,通过比对,只需要将列表中的每项数据向前移几位就是对的的次序,首尾是相连的,假如第一项前移1位,那么就移动到了末位。
例如列表中的数据為1,2,3,4,5,每项数据向前移1位,那么移动后列表中的数据就变為2,3,4,5,1。
(1)准备工作
在预留文献中的小紅角色中编程。
列表【list】已预留,可以直接使用。
(2)功能实現
1)代码运行后,程序会问询需要前移的次数。
2)根据输入的数字,让列表中的数据前移指定的次数。
(3)评分原则
1)有问询回答构
原创力文档


文档评论(0)